Though all our Batteries are eco-friendly and maintenance-free, a few precautions would further ensure their longevity. |
 |
Use only distilled water for top-ups and do not overfill. |
 |
Periodically check the voltage regulator output as over and under charging can be harmful to the battery.
|
 |
In case of maintenance-free (MF) batteries, vent plugs can be opened with a rupee coin. |
 |
To protect the batteries from damage, recharge at recommended current (amps) only. |
 |
Do not keep normal batteries idle for more than 3-4 weeks and MF batteries idle for more than 10-12 weeks. |
 |
Do not operate or charge battery if electrolyte temperature exceeds 60 o C. |
 |
When charging, ensure that the current is not more than 1/20 of the rated AH capacity. |
 |
Put the correct capacity of battery in the vehicle to get the best performance.
|
 |
When placing battery, ensure that it is secured firmly in the cradle. |
 |
lways keep terminals and clamps clean and grease-free and never hammer down the clamps. |
 |
Ensure that the clamps are always firmly tightened. |
 |
Make sure the connecting cables are fixed to the correct poles. (first +ve to -ve then ve to +ve) |
 |
Apply petroleum Jelly on the terminal cable clams but never apply grease. |
